Saint Louis University is a private Catholic research university with two campuses: one in Saint Louis, Missouri, USA, and an international campus in Madrid, Spain. It is the oldest university west of the Mississippi River and the oldest Catholic university in the United States, founded in 1818. For nearly 50 years, the university has been distinguished by its world-class academics and faculty, offering research that has contributed to global change. It has a strong commitment to faith and service to both students and the community. The Madrid campus is the first university campus operated by an American institution in Europe and the first American university to be officially recognized by Spain’s Higher Education Authority as a foreign institution, which reflects its international reputation. The university serves 13,000 students, providing a rigorous education that helps them develop into bold and confident leaders. It is ranked among the top 100 research universities in the U.S., with more than 20 undergraduate and graduate programs ranked within the top 100 in the United States, according to US News & World Report.
